Welcome to Bangkok! Start your trip by checking into your hotel and freshening up. In the morning, take a stroll along the vibrant streets of Sukhumvit and explore the local markets like Chatuchak Weekend Market, where you can find unique souvenirs and enjoy delicious street food.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the city's rich culture and history by visiting the Grand Palace and Wat Phra Kaew. As the evening sets in, head to Khao San Road, a famous nightlife spot, and enjoy the lively atmosphere, live music, street performances, and vibrant bars.
Start your day with an adrenaline-filled adventure at the Flight of the Gibbon, an exciting zipline course located in the lush rainforest near Bangkok. Enjoy a thrilling experience while ziplining through the treetops and admiring the stunning natural surroundings. Afterward, head to the Sea Life Bangkok Ocean World, located in the Siam Paragon mall, where you can explore over 30,000 marine creatures and even walk through an underwater tunnel. In the evening, indulge in the vibrant nightlife of Thonglor and Ekkamai, known for their trendy bars, clubs, and rooftop venues.
After two adventurous days, it's time to relax and rejuvenate. Start your day by visiting the Damnoen Saduak Floating Market, where you can experience the unique atmosphere of a traditional Thai market on boats. Enjoy shopping for souvenirs, trying local delicacies, and taking a leisurely boat ride. In the afternoon, pamper yourself with a traditional Thai massage at one of the city's renowned spas. As the evening approaches, head to Asiatique The Riverfront, a lively night market situated by the Chao Phraya River, offering shopping, dining, and entertainment options.
For a unique experience off the beaten path, consider visiting Soi Cowboy, a red-light district known for its vibrant nightlife and adult entertainment venues. It's a popular spot for bachelor parties. Another hidden gem is Nana Plaza, which offers a similar atmosphere with its go-go bars and lively nightlife scene. Make sure to explore the local street food scene as well, where you can find delicious and affordable dishes at places like Chinatown's Yaowarat Road and the Rod Fai Night Market.
